Output ebba3078db5fabcf6121c59a3ec976e36750c73b44246d0871c15f4c98440244:1

value
2565987
script pubkey
OP_0 OP_PUSHBYTES_20 e8716c7ca2a3aef1725eea22597bcc0e2a42d9f6
address
bc1qapckcl9z5wh0zuj7ag39j77vpc4y9k0k5mu2hs
transaction
ebba3078db5fabcf6121c59a3ec976e36750c73b44246d0871c15f4c98440244
spent
true